Tonnex opens in Sydney

Printer distributor, Tonnex, will open a Sydney office to join its Brisbane and Melbourne locations.
The new office will be dedicated to sales and customer support, and will have space for eight staff. Tonnex director, George Kozman, said the wholesaler already had two staff in Sydney and was bringing on a third. He was hoping the location will be filled in 12 months.
"Between the three locations we feel we are able to service anywhere in Australia. We have a number of clients in the west but the east cost is more ideal for us at this stage," he said.
Tonnex has also recently revamped its reseller rewards program, which provides its 850 registered resellers with a points-based rewards system per dollar spent. Kozman said the program was expanded based on feedback from the previous year's program.
Epson and Brother have joined HP in supporting the rewards program.
